Nagoya and the surrounding Aichi Prefecture represent the absolute heartland of Japan’s manufacturing (Monozukuri) sector. With global leaders in automotive technology, robotics, and advanced machine tools headquartered here, the local demand for ultra-precise micro-drives has shifted drastically toward Brushless DC (BLDC) technology.
As factory lines integrate IoT, artificial intelligence, and collaborative robots (cobots), the requirements for high torque-to-weight ratios, silent operation, and long lifespans have become standard. In the macro-industrial landscape, the shift from traditional brushed DC motors to brushless variations is driven by the global push for decarbonization and energy efficiency. Carbon reduction goals force engineers to rethink motor efficiency classes, demanding configurations that operate above 85% efficiency ranges even in micro and fractional horsepower drives.
From active grill shutters and thermal management pumps to electronic throttle actuators, brushless systems offer the thermal resilience needed to handle continuous operation in high-heat engine chambers or modern electric vehicle battery compartments.
Cobots require highly dynamic torque outputs and low rotor inertia. By employing high-grade NdFeB magnets, our brushless motors provide instant mechanical response, enabling precise safety stops and smooth arm joints in pick-and-place systems.
Ultra-quiet, low-vibration brushless units are critical for medical devices, centrifugal pumps, and laboratory automation. Dual-channel hall sensor assemblies provide absolute positioning signals for precise dosage and movement.

The micro-drive industry is undergoing rapid technical evolution. To help our Nagoya-based clients plan their product cycles, we focus on three core areas in our technological roadmap:
Integrating Field Oriented Control (FOC) directly on micro-drive PCBs to reduce external wiring and lower overall footprint.
Developing coreless BLDC configurations to resolve cogging issues, delivering ultra-smooth rotation for high-precision optical equipment.
Upgrading powder metallurgy and hobbing capabilities to offer planetary gears capable of operating at higher reduction ranges.
Integrating thermal sensors and vibration logging algorithms inside the motor housing for predictive maintenance applications.
